Gary Helmling Gary Helmling is a Lead Software Engineer at Meetup, where he builds scalable and easy to use tools for finding and organizing local groups. Prior to joining Meetup, he helped organize the world's local birding groups at the National Audubon Society, and worked with startups developing online 3D mapping and e-commerce solutions for telecom and financial industry customers.
As Managing Partner of Reliant Security, Richard Newman is responsible for the company's day-to-day operations, as well as its strategic direction. A technologist at heart, Newman has more than sixteen years of experience in applications and infrastructure. A lead party in five successful start-ups, along with extensive experience consulting to numerous retailers, he is adept at working with both small and large organizations. His technical expertise extends to LANs, WANS, voice and data systems, wireless networks, enterprise storage and SANs, enterprise server platforms, legacy environments and information security. In addition to network and systems design, he has worked extensively creating software applications and brings a disciplined approach to Reliants product development efforts. Newman graduated in 1991 from Columbia University in New York City. Geir Magnusson, Jr. Geir Magnusson has a diverse background as both a technical executive and an internationally reknown leader in open source software. Magnusson has held executive positions at Joost, Gluecode/IBM, Apdeptra, Intel and FitLinxx. He is a member of the board of advisors for WSO2, an open source SOA middleware vendor. In addition to Magnusson's commercial software experience, he is a director of the Apache Software Foundation, currently represents the ASF on the executive committee of the Java Community Process and helped found major open source projects, including Apache Geronimo and Apache Harmony, and has been recognized for his work in the Java ecosystem through a Google-O'Reilly Open Source Award. |
